Found this sharp photo in a Lexibell folder on Baseball Birthdays. This photo was labeled "about 1940," which would have been Myers' final season with the Reds. Named the Reds' captain for the 1935 season, he had a love/hate relationship with the Cincy fans in part due to a horrid 1939 World Series (the Lombardi snooze series) in which the Reds were swept 4-0. They won again in 1940, but Myers was frequently the target of boos by the home crowd. He actually walked away from the team on the eve of the World Series, but was talked into returning. He drove in the winning run in the eighth inning of Game 7 for the Reds, then was traded to the Cubs. Named to the Reds Hall of Fame in 1966.
